Unfortunately, our stay was far below expectations. The biggest issue was the persistent unpleasant smell coming from the air conditioning. We were moved to another room the following day, but exactly the same problem existed there as well.
Communication was also difficult, as many members of the staff spoke very limited English, making it hard to resolve even simple issues. On several occasions, we felt that our concerns were not taken seriously, which was disappointing.
The problems appeared to go beyond individual employees. The overall impression was of a hotel suffering from poor maintenance and a lack of proper management. The condition of the building, the air conditioning system, the swimming pools, and several common areas suggested that the property is not being maintained to the standard expected from a PortAventura hotel.
The only people who made a positive difference were the reception team, who genuinely tried to help, and the staff at Saula Café, who were consistently friendly, professional, and welcoming.
We are frequent theme park travellers and visit theme parks every year. Unfortunately, this was one of the most disappointing hotel stays we have experienced. We sincerely hope the management invests in improving the facilities, maintenance, and overall customer service, as the hotel has great potential but currently falls well below expectations.

First the reception, got here at 10am and the the line at the reception was long and slow. We had a full board package with 2 days of tickets and fast passes. The person at the reception explained that everything is connected to the room key and the QR code on it, including our food at the park and the fast passes. However, 1 hour later at the park when we tried to use it, turned out there is a separate fast pass ticket required which we were not given. Nobody at the park was willing to help, long line at the customer service and they sent me back to the hotel to get it resolved. 2 hours wasted. The hotel offered me 3 drinks as a compensation. Half the self-service food places which are part of the package in the park did not work. Nobody mentioned that either. So again, we wasted a lot of time to find a place to eat. Rooms are very dated, as we walked down a very long hallway of the ground floor, the carpets were stained, covered with dirt, all door corners were cracking with white spackle on the carpet, room smelled of wet cement and dust.
They are trying to reproduce the American amusement park experience but forgot about one key aspect of it - the customer service. It is vertically non-existent, especially if you don’t speak Spanish.
